Transaction baa7e2494ff527256d9fff1e2100017412d88d323be3696072067318026d8b4b
1 Input
1 Output
-
baa7e2494ff527256d9fff1e2100017412d88d323be3696072067318026d8b4b:0
- value
- 20897818
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7d24a3ebdda203af34e31aecf9a769b8ea4b6bc
- address
- bc1q6lfy504amgsr4u6wxxhvlxnknw82fd4uqk8afv